更换FOS的模板不能很好地工作。因为我有一些你不知道的问题。可以看得更清楚,请告诉我。
MyBundle.php
class MyBundle extends Bundle {
public function getParent() {
return 'FOSUserBundle';
}
}MyBundle\Resources\FOSUserBundle\views\Security\login.html.twig
{% extends "FOSUserBundle::layout.html.twig" %}
{% block fos_user_content %}
{% if error %}
<div>{{ error|trans({}, 'FOSUserBundle') }}</div>
{% endif %}
{% block title %}Demo Login{% endblock %}
{% block content %}
{% block fos_user_content %}{% endblock %}
{% endblock %}
{% endblock fos_user_content %}将显示login.html.twig的\ Resources \ views \ Security目录下的vendor \ friendsofsymfony \ user-bundle \ FOS \ UserBundle内容。
发布于 2014-11-11 14:03:20
将你的文件放在app目录中
app\Resources\FOSUserBundle\views\Security\login.html.twig并清除缓存。
https://stackoverflow.com/questions/26856412
复制相似问题